Setting a Sustainable Vision

Decide which wins matter most: waste diverted from landfills, low‑VOC indoor air, or energy savings. Write down targets, like reusing 40% of furnishings and choosing only third‑party verified finishes. Share your goals in the comments to inspire accountability and momentum.

Prioritize sofas with replaceable covers, FSC wood frames, and natural or recycled textiles. Organic cotton, linen, hemp, or recycled polyester blends balance comfort and responsibility. Circular Decor and Upcycling Wins

Hunt for solid wood tables, metal floor lamps, and woven baskets at local shops or online marketplaces. Older pieces often outlast fast furniture and tell richer stories. Drop a comment with your best vintage score and what it replaced at home.

Circular Decor and Upcycling Wins

Sanding an old table and finishing it with plant‑based oil can reveal stunning grain while avoiding new materials. Swap damaged hardware for salvaged brass pulls. Share before‑and‑after shots to encourage readers who worry they’re not “handy” enough to try.

Plants as Gentle Allies

While plants are not full‑blown air purifiers, species like snake plants and pothos bring humidity balance, visual calm, and a daily reminder to slow down. Choose peat‑free soil and reuse pots. Ask our community for pet‑safe plant favorites to suit your space.

Ventilation and Ongoing Care

Cross‑ventilate after painting or assembling furniture, and vacuum with a HEPA filter to reduce fine dust. Wash removable cushion covers regularly with cold water to save energy. Share your cleaning routine so we can build a sustainable care checklist together.

Quiet Comfort Upgrades

Add natural wool rugs or cork underlay to soften echoes and reduce noise. Use thick curtains to temper street sound while improving insulation. If you’ve switched to a quieter fan or purifier, tell us how it changed movie nights and reading sessions.

Flexible Zones

Float your sofa, tuck a reading chair near daylight, and keep pathways open. Mobile side tables and modular shelving adapt easily to guests or hobbies. Share a quick sketch or phone photo of your floor plan; we’ll suggest low‑impact tweaks.

A Palette That Endures

Choose a grounded base—oat, clay, olive, ink—then layer seasonal color with cushions or throws made from natural fibers. This approach reduces repainting and impulse décor purchases. Tell us your three anchor colors, and we’ll propose complementary accents.

Durability Over Disposability

Favor repairable frames, slipcovered seating, and furniture with replaceable parts. Keep a small kit of screws, touch‑up paint, and fabric patches on hand. Comment with items you plan to repair this month, and celebrate the carbon you kept from the curb.
